AlNiCo magnetic material, an alloy of aluminum, nickel, cobalt, iron, and copper, is valued for its exceptional temperature stability, high residual induction, and strong energy product, making it a dependable choice for precision applications. Although its low coercive force restricts its use in high-demagnetization environments, AlNiCo performs reliably in applications requiring stable operation across a broad temperature range. The material exhibits excellent corrosion resistance, often eliminating the need for surface treatments, though coatings can be applied for cosmetic or protective purposes. These properties make AlNiCo magnets well-suited for sensors, motors, instruments, and other precision devices where thermal stability and durability are critical.
